Job description

This position will start as a Contract with the intention to convert to full-time employment

The Strategic Sourcing and Procurement Professional is a highly experienced Sourcing Lead in the development and execution of strategic sourcing strategies for complex goods and services. This role focuses 3rd Party Expense Management and Category Strategy for Global Technology Services (GTS) and IT Management Services.

They collaborate with internal stakeholders to identify cost‑saving opportunities, manage supplier relationships, and negotiate favorable contract terms while ensuring compliance with company policies and best practices for the following categories of spend: FinOps, End User Support, Global Technology Operations such as Compute Storage and IaaS, Cloud Engineering, and Enterprise Technology (ETOC) such as Network Technologies, Digital Workplace Solutions, Endpoint Resilience, Endpoint Technology, Telecom, and Collaboration Technology.
